The finalists for the annual Bay of Plenty ExportNZ Awards have been announced.
The awards are dedicated to showcasing exporters from our region and their people who are creating their own beats.
Into its 27th year, the awards recognise ‘the innovative, the brave and the successful'. They acknowledge those companies that have helped grow and transform New Zealand and local economies with exceptional export success.
They bring the local export community together to inspire one another and they provide a snapshot of amazing local export stories that might otherwise go unnoticed.
2017 Bay of Plenty ExportNZ Awards Finalists:
YOU Travel Emerging Exporter of the Year Award
George and Willy
KiwiPharma
Kiwi Produce
Roholm (the company behind the Inverse Hair Conditioning System)
Page Macrae Engineering Innovation in Export Award
Enzed Exotics
Radfords Software
Steens Honey
Beca Export Achievement Award
Felipe Aguilera - Oasis Engineering
Hyun Taek Yang - Tauranga Korean Times (a NZ recognised agency working with Education Tauranga)
Robin Piggott - Dominion Salt
Sharp Tudhope Lawyers Exporter of the Year Award
Dominion Salt
Ziwi
The winners of the 2017 awards will be announced, plus the surprise recipient of the New Zealand Trade & Enterprise 'Service to Export' Award, at a Rio Carnival themed extravaganza dinner on Friday, June 23 at ASB Arena, Tauranga.
